The Samsung Galaxy S21 is better than Galaxy A8 (2018), with a 91.8 score against 79.2. Samsung Galaxy S21 is a notably newer device, and it is also just a little bit thinner and a bit lighter than the Galaxy A8 (2018). Galaxy S21 features a much better looking screen than Samsung Galaxy A8 (2018), because although it has a quite inferior quantity of pixels per display inch, it also counts with a little bit larger screen and a little bit higher 1080 x 2400 resolution.
The Galaxy S21 has a bit better processor than Galaxy A8 (2018), and although they both have the same number of cores, the Galaxy S21 also has more RAM. Samsung Galaxy A8 (2018) features a slightly better memory capacity to store more apps and games than Galaxy S21, because although it has only 64 GB internal memory, it also counts with a SD extension slot that admits a maximum of 256 GB.
Samsung Galaxy S21 features a superior camera than Samsung Galaxy A8 (2018), because although it has a way worse 12 megapixels resolution back camera and a smaller aperture which is not so good for low-light images and video, it also counts with a way better 7680x4320 video definition. Samsung Galaxy S21 counts with better battery lifetime than Galaxy A8 (2018), because it has 4000mAh of battery capacity.
